Wireshark是一款流行的网络分析工具,它能够捕获网络数据包并展示数据包的内容。Wireshark提供了强大的分析功能,可以帮助网络管理员深入理解网络流量,并快速定位网络问题。
Wireshark的界面简单直观,使用者可以快速上手。用户可以选择在捕获网络数据包之前配置捕获过滤器,以便只捕获感兴趣的数据包。此外,Wireshark还提供了丰富的过滤器选项,以便对捕获的数据包进行分析。
Wireshark的数据展示功能十分强大。用户可以通过Wireshark查看TCP、UDP、ICMP等网络协议的细节,并且可以查看数据包的完整内容。此外,Wireshark还可以对网络流量进行统计分析,并且可以根据不同的条件对网络流量进行分类。
Wireshark不仅可以展示数据包的内容,还可以对数据包进行编辑。用户可以修改数据包的源IP地址、目的IP地址、源端口、目的端口等信息。Wireshark还提供了流重组的功能,能够将数据包按照流的方式重新组合。
在网络问题排查方面,Wireshark是一个非常有用的工具。当网络出现问题时,可以使用Wireshark捕获数据包,通过分析数据包的内容来快速定位问题。例如,当网络出现延迟问题时,可以通过Wireshark分析TCP连接的ACK响应时间,以便找到问题所在。
总之,Wireshark是一款十分强大的网络分析工具,能够帮助网络管理员深入理解网络流量,并且可以快速定位网络问题。无论是在网络故障排查还是网络安全方面,Wireshark都是一个十分有用的工具。
文章结束。
随着互联网技术的发展,现代Web开发中JavaScript已经成为了一门必不可少的编程语言。它的重要性在于,JavaScript可以在客户端(即用户的浏览器端)进行实时的动态操作,从而增强了网站的交互性和用户体验。
JavaScript最初是为了在浏览器中实现简单的表单验证和动态效果而诞生的。然而,随着Web应用程序变得越来越复杂,JavaScript的作用也变得越来越重要。现在,许多Web应用程序都是以JavaScript作为主要的开发语言,这是因为JavaScript具有以下几个优点:
首先,JavaScript非常容易学习和使用。它的语法简洁明了,而且有大量的文档和示例代码可供参考。即使是初学者也可以很快地上手编写一些简单的JavaScript代码。
其次,JavaScript具有良好的跨平台性。由于它可以在不同的浏览器和操作系统上运行,因此开发人员可以使用JavaScript来构建具有广泛兼容性的Web应用程序。
第三,JavaScript可以实现非常复杂的功能。它可以用于创建动态网页、交互式表单、AJAX应用程序、游戏等等。在现代Web开发中,几乎所有的复杂功能都可以用JavaScript来实现。
第四,JavaScript具有丰富的库和框架。开发人员可以使用许多流行的JavaScript库和框架,如jQuery、React、Vue等等,来加速开发过程并提高代码的质量。
总的来说,JavaScript已经成为了现代Web开发的重要组成部分。通过掌握JavaScript,开发人员可以创建出更加丰富、更加交互式的Web应用程序,从而提高用户的满意度和体验。同时,随着JavaScript的不断发展和演进,它在Web开发中的重要性也将不断增加。
因此,无论是新手还是经验丰富的Web开发人员,在学习和使用JavaScript时都应该充分认识到它的重要性,并且不断学习和探索其更深层次的用法,以便在Web开发领域取得更好的成果。